3 Reasons Why Launching a Website Deserves a Party

 

I’m not going to lie. We will find just about any reason to have a party here at CWS. We’re big fans of cheese platters, fruit spreads, and red wine. Lately we’ve decided to get our clients in on the action, invite them over, and start having parties with a purpose: Celebrating the launch of their brand new websites. After the Possabilities and Common Cents launch parties we’d like to share why we think a party is 10 times better than a simple “You’re website is launched” email.

 

1) It becomes an experience rather than an event

A lot of time and planning goes into making a website. Depending how complex you want the website to be it can be 3 to 4 months or more before the process is complete. Not having a party to celebrate the completion seems so anticlimactic. We want to make the launch something to remember for our clients.

I think the quote from Renee Berg, Marketing & Development Director of PossAbilities sums up the experience nicely, “Your space, the atmosphere, your staff, the willingness to host, share the space and give tours – it made our new website reveal an ‘it’ moment”.

 

2) It gives the product a package

Companies like Apple understand the importance of packaging better than anyone else. Even before becoming CEO, Steve Jobs once shut done production of the boxes for their new line of computers which was already behind schedule. Why? Because the package was not a bright enough white. Steve knew that the opening of the package is part of the experience and can build anticipation for the product.

The same can be said for “opening” your new website. It’s pretty boring to just throw the website on the screen and say “Well, there it is”. The food, the friends, the games, the music, the gigantic launch button… they’re all part of the “packaging” that builds anticipation for that moment when you get to see the website for the very first time.

 

3) The website becomes your own

In marketing, placing a product in the hands of your customer can give them a sense of ownership. To launch your website, we let you get comfortable on the couch in front of the big screen. You get handed the mouse to click the giant launch button. This is almost like the passing of a torch. At that point it feels like the website has been passed on and you can truly call it your own.

 

It’s fun to have a party. When you can have a party with your friends and clients to make their website launch a special event…that's even better.
